Abstract

The invention relates to a Cuora trifasciata hatching method comprising the following operating steps: preparing river sands and clays in a Cuora trifasciata expected period of confinement, evenly mixing said materials into sandy soil, exposing the sandy soil under the sun, and placing the sandy soil into a standby box body; selecting oosperms and burying the oosperms into the sandy soil at certain intervals without 24 hours after the Cuora trifasciata lays eggs, and transferring the box body into a room; controlling the sand soil water content to be 6-8%, and setting the sandy soil temperature to be 25-27 DEG C so as to hatch male young turtles, or setting the sandy soil to be 29.2-29.8 DEG C so as to hatch female young turtles; regularly checking hatching conditions in every 2-3 days, timely spotting bad eggs and removing the bad eggs. The method can scientifically control the hatching environment temperature and humidity, so the Cuora trifasciata oosperms can be hatched in a better environment, thus effectively improving Cuora trifasciata hatching rate, and scientifically controlling young turtle sex gender proportion; the Cuora trifasciata hatching method can reasonably select sandy soil as hatching medium, is clean in environment, simple in hatching steps, low in cost, high in benefits, and easy to realize.

During practical operation, need to scarifying before Cyclemys trifasciata is laid eggs, the sandy soil that are exposed to the sun on spawning ground, if desired it is carried out disinfection, sand moisture with hands pinch agglomerating, loose one's grip i.e. to dissipate and be advisable.Careful procuratorial work every day Cyclemys trifasciata to be produced and spawning ground is needed between Cyclemys trifasciata expected date of confinement.When finding that vestige of laying eggs then gets casing ready, casing can be bubble chamber, carton or plastic box, casing neglect greatly germ cell quantity depending on, be typically chosen length, width and height and be respectively 40~80 centimetres, 40~80 centimetres, the casing of 40~60 centimetres.Casing for hatching can be uncovered casing, it is also possible to be the perisporium casing that has passage.The sandy soil after the sun is exposed to the sun sterilization of 15~30 cm thick are put in casing, after Cyclemys trifasciata is laid eggs in 24 hours, the method using light-illuminating is told germ cell and is collected, imbeds in sandy soil, when with light-illuminating Testudinis ovum, if there are white annulus or white macula in ovum central authorities, then it it is germ cell.
During hatching, the moist degree of sandy soil and air humidity directly affect the fetal development of germ cell, air humidity is excessive, sand water content is too high, it is easily caused germ cell to suffocate necrosis, air humidity is too small, sand water content is low, then germ cell is easily downright bad because moisture excessive evaporation " dries up ", therefore by the humid control of sandy soil 6%~8%, air humidity is maintained at 80%~90%, most beneficial for embryo's normal development of germ cell in housing environment.Temperature plays an important role in hatching process, and the height of temperature affects fetal development speed, the length of incubation period and the sex of young Testudinis.
Generally, in the range of 22~33 DEG C, the highest fetal development of the temperature time faster, hatching is the shortest, on the contrary then the fetal development time relatively slow, hatching the longest.Therefore, it is male for can making the major part hatched young Testudinis when being controlled by sandy soil temperature in the range of 25 DEG C~27 DEG C, and when being controlled by sandy soil temperature in the range of 29.2 DEG C~29.8 DEG C, it is female for can making the young Testudinis of the major part hatched.
In casing, sandy soil thickness is advisable with 15~30 centimetres, in order to ensure that sandy soil have good breathability and retentiveness concurrently, in sandy soil, the mixed proportion of river sand and clay is 0.8: 1~1: 0.8, this ratio is conducive to making sandy soil keep suitable humidity and air circulation, make germ cell hatch in suitable environment, be effectively improved hatchability.
Germ cell embedment sandy soil are crossed and deeply easily occurs that germ cell is suffocated, imbedding shallow, easily being changed by ambient temperature and damp condition is affected, therefore the degree of depth in germ cell embedment sandy soil is advisable with 8~14 centimetres, and this depth bounds can preferably ensure that germ cell is hatched in the condition of constant temperature and humidity.The spacing of germ cell should be at 2~5 centimetres, and this distance range had both given the incubation space that germ cell is enough, keep each germ cell not interact, ensured again the concordance of incubation condition.In sandy soil, the particle diameter of river sand is 0.3~1.0 millimeter, the particle diameter of clay is 0.05~0.2 millimeter, particle diameter is that the river sand of 0.3~1.0 millimeter can make sandy soil keep good breathability, particle diameter is that the clay of 0.05~0.2 millimeter then makes sandy soil have preferable retentiveness, plays constant temperature and humidity effect.Certainly, it may also be necessary to joining the Vermiculitum having particle diameter to be 0.3~0.7 millimeter in sandy soil, its Main Function is sandy soil are risen insulation effect, the most also suppress the effect of fungus growth, virus killing, ensure that germ cell is the most infected.
Below in conjunction with specific embodiment, the present invention is further described:
Embodiment 1
Between Cyclemys trifasciata expected date of confinement, every day checks that spawning ground is once, after finding that Cyclemys trifasciata is laid eggs, river sand and clay is got ready by the component ratio of 1: 1, and river sand and clay are uniformly mixed into sandy soil, insert after the sun is exposed to the sun sterilization length, width and height be respectively 50 centimetres, 50 centimetres, stand-by in the casing of 40 centimetres, inserting the sandy soil cladding thickness in casing is 30 centimetres.After Cyclemys trifasciata is laid eggs in 24 hours, using light-illuminating mode to tell germ cell, and germ cell collected and imbed in sandy soil, the degree of depth in germ cell embedment sandy soil is equidistantly to discharge with the interval of 2 centimetres between 10 centimetres, and each germ cell.Then casing is moved to indoor, by the water content control of sandy soil be 6%~8%, the air humidity of hatching casing is maintained at 80%~90% sandy soil temperature and controls to be 29.5 DEG C of constant temperature.Checked every 2 days and once hatch situation, find that bad ovum is removed in time.After about 60 days, young Testudinis pips successively, and major part is female young Testudinis, and young Testudinis needs after hatching to take out in time in order to avoid affecting the hatching of remaining germ cell, until all incubating oosperms are complete.
Embodiment 2
Between Cyclemys trifasciata expected date of confinement, every day checks that spawning ground is once, after finding that Cyclemys trifasciata is laid eggs, river sand and clay is got ready by the component ratio of 0.8: 1, and river sand and clay are uniformly mixed into sandy soil, insert after the sun is exposed to the sun sterilization length, width and height be respectively 60 centimetres, 60 centimetres, stand-by in the casing of 50 centimetres, inserting the sandy soil thickness in casing is 30 centimetres.After Cyclemys trifasciata is laid eggs in 24 hours, using light-illuminating mode tell germ cell and imbed in sandy soil, the degree of depth in embedment sandy soil is equidistantly to discharge with the interval of 3 centimetres between 12 centimetres and each germ cell.Then casing is moved to indoor by the water content control of sandy soil be 7%~8%, the air humidity of hatching casing be maintained at 85%~88%, it is 26.5 DEG C of constant temperature that sandy soil temperature controls.Checked every 3 days and once hatch situation, find that bad ovum is removed in time.After about 65 days, young Testudinis pips successively, and major part is male young Testudinis, and young Testudinis needs after hatching to take out in time in order to avoid affecting the continuation hatching of remaining germ cell, until all incubating oosperms are complete.
If Cyclemys trifasciata fails to find in time germ cell in laying eggs latter 24 hours, do not hatch by above way, but stay at original place hatching and insert board mark in its vicinity.
